You can pre-order this item and we will dispatch it to you upon its release.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ationMichelle Mackintosh is one of Australia's most awarded book designers. She has co-authored seven children's books, with her husband Steve, and has written multiple travel books on Japan. Her visits there inspire much of her design aesthetic and writing style. Cat Rabbit is a textile artist based in Melbourne, Australia. Using felt, recycled and vintage fabrics, Cat hand stitches plush sculptural works of her imagined characters and the worlds they might live in. Her work translates to many formats - from children's books to large scale felt installations to magazine editorials - always with the aim of bringing softness and warmth to the viewer.
